Replacing your windows involves several moving parts that change the final bill. The biggest factor is the frame material, as vinyl tends to be more budget-friendly while wood or custom fiberglass options sit on the higher end. You also have to consider the glass packages—things like double versus triple panes or extra coatings for energy efficiency can shift the cost. The complexity of the installation matters, too, such as whether your frames need repairs or if you are switching from a standard window to a bay or bow style. For Jersey City's climate, energy-efficient double- or triple-pane windows offer excellent value by reducing heating and cooling costs. Vinyl frames are often a durable and cost-effective choice. Yes, replacing 30-year-old windows in Jersey City is almost always a worthwhile investment. Older windows typically lack modern energy efficiency, leading to higher utility bills and reduced comfort. New windows can significantly improve your home's performance, security, and its overall value.
